Konstantinovo
Village
Photo: A.Savin,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Konstantinovo is a rural locality in Kuzminsky Rural Settlement, Rybnovsky District, Ryazan Oblast, Russia. Population: 359 ; 369 ; Konstantinovo is known for being the birthplace of poet Sergei Yesenin. Konstantinovo is situated 9 km north of Putkovo.
